Troubleshooting Connection Refusal Errors
When a «connection refused» error appears, especially when trying to reach a specific online casino, a few steps can be taken. First, it’s essential to rule out local network issues. This involves restarting your modem and router, clearing your browser’s cache and cookies, and trying to access other websites to confirm your internet connection is generally functional. If other sites load correctly, the problem likely lies with the target website or your connection to it.
Next, consider if the website itself is down. Online casinos, like any web service, can experience temporary server problems or planned maintenance. Checking social media, forums, or using website status checker tools can sometimes provide insight. If the problem persists across multiple devices and networks, and other websites are accessible, it strongly suggests that the website you’re trying to reach, such as www.bindingsites.co.uk, is experiencing a technical difficulty that prevents it from accepting connections.
